Is there be any right of appeal against the levels of allowances for each Broad Rental Market Area determined by the Rent Officer?
No, because the BRMA covers an area which includes other tenants, any appeal received could ultimately change the LHA rate for tenants who have not appealed and are content with their allowance. This is because any decision would have to be implemented to all tenants receiving that BRMA / LHA rate. However, the BRMA area will be subject to review.
